DOVER SYMPHONY ANNOUNCES SPRING CLASSICAL CONCERT

 

Dover Symphony Orchestra
“Dvorak and More” Spring Classical Concert
Stefan Xhori, Violin Soloist

 

The Dover Symphony Orchestra under the direction of Donald Buxton, will launch the second half of its 2016-2017 season on Sunday, March 19, 2017, 3:00 p.m. at the Dover Downs Rollins Center.

Centerpiece of the concert is Dvorak’s well-known Symphony in E Minor, From the New World. Stefan Xhori, our talented concertmaster, will be the featured soloist for Dvorak’s Romance for violin and orchestra. Additional works by Tschaikowsky and Moussorgsky will be performed.

Mr. Xhori has been an active performer in Albania, his native country, Greece and France, and continues to play with many organizations in the tristate area since he moved to the US in 1993. He teaches violin in Dover at the Music School of Delaware and at his home studio.
